Principle Of Virtual Work Definition Relation Advantages The principle of virtual work definitions: virtual work is the work done by a real force acting through a virtual displace ment or a virtual force acting through a real displacement. a virtual displacement is any displacement consistent with the constraints of the structure, i.e., that satisfy the boundary conditions at the supports. The virtual work method, also referred to as the method of virtual force or unit load method, uses the law of conservation of energy to obtain the deflection and slope at a point in a structure. this method was developed in 1717 by john bernoulli. to illustrate the principle of virtual work, consider the deformable body shown in figure 8.1. Virtual work is the total work done by the applied forces and the inertial forces of a mechanical system as it moves through a set of virtual displacements. when considering forces applied to a body in static equilibrium, the principle of least action requires the virtual work of these forces to be zero. Definition. from the physical point of view, the principle of virtual work is an attempt to characterize unequivocally an equilibrium configuration of a mechanical system (as defined in statics (q.v.)) by observing how it reacts to a small kinematical perturbation, called a virtual displacement.
